Ereignis: Unterschied zwischen den Versionen

Aus OrgaMon Wiki
Zur Navigation springen Zur Suche springen
Keine Bearbeitungszusammenfassung
Keine Bearbeitungszusammenfassung
Zeile 1: Zeile 1:
[[Bild: Ereignisse.PNG|800px]]
[[Bild: Ereignisse.PNG|800px]]
Buchungsvorgänge im OrgaMon-Geschäftskern erzeugen Ereignisse. Auf Basis dieser Ereignisse können wiederum Aktion, wie z.B. ein eMail-Versand angesteuert werden. Im Moment werden folgende Arten bei den Ereignissen unterschieden:
<code>
  // EREIGNIS-Typen für Geschäftsabläufe
  // wird auch für Ticket-Arten verwendet
  eT_BestellungNunVollstaendigLieferbar = 1;
  eT_BestellungNunTeilweiseLieferbar = 2;
  eT_BestellungMerkmalTeilweiseLieferbarVerloren = 3;
  eT_WareEingetroffen = 4;
  eT_LagerPlatzZugeteilt = 5;
  eT_LagerPlatzFreigabe = 6;
  eT_BelegScan = 7;
  eT_Miniscore = 8; // wird vom WebShop erzeugt!
  eT_WareRausgegangen = 9;
  eT_WareBestellt = 10;
  eT_ZahlungPerLastschrift = 11;
  eT_ForderungsAusgleich = 12;
  eT_KatalogVersendung = 13; // macht Alexander selbst
  eT_PaketIDErhalten = 14; // Es war möglich eine Versand-ID zuzuteilen
</code>

Version vom 9. Mai 2008, 16:29 Uhr

Buchungsvorgänge im OrgaMon-Geschäftskern erzeugen Ereignisse. Auf Basis dieser Ereignisse können wiederum Aktion, wie z.B. ein eMail-Versand angesteuert werden. Im Moment werden folgende Arten bei den Ereignissen unterschieden:

 // EREIGNIS-Typen für Geschäftsabläufe
 // wird auch für Ticket-Arten verwendet
 eT_BestellungNunVollstaendigLieferbar = 1;
 eT_BestellungNunTeilweiseLieferbar = 2;
 eT_BestellungMerkmalTeilweiseLieferbarVerloren = 3;
 eT_WareEingetroffen = 4;
 eT_LagerPlatzZugeteilt = 5;
 eT_LagerPlatzFreigabe = 6;
 eT_BelegScan = 7;
 eT_Miniscore = 8; // wird vom WebShop erzeugt!
 eT_WareRausgegangen = 9;
 eT_WareBestellt = 10;
 eT_ZahlungPerLastschrift = 11;
 eT_ForderungsAusgleich = 12;
 eT_KatalogVersendung = 13; // macht Alexander selbst
 eT_PaketIDErhalten = 14; // Es war möglich eine Versand-ID zuzuteilen